Ilang beteranong mamamahayag ang itinalaga ng Malacañang sa iba't ibang ahensiya ng pamahalaan, kabilang si Jose "Joe" Torres Jr., na bagong director general ng Philippine Information Agency (PIA).

Ayon sa anunsiyo ng Presidential Communications Office, pinalitan ni Torres sa nasabing posisyon ang nagbitiw na si Ramon Cualoping III.

"I have announced to the PIA officials and my staff this development. I ensure a smooth transition to my successor once the Office of the President announces it," sabi ni Cualoping sa Facebook post.

Samantala, itinalaga naman bilang bagong executive director of the Presidential Task Force on Media Security (PTFoMS), si Paulino Gutierrez.

Pinalitan ni Gutierrez sa naturang posisyon si Joel Sy Egco, na isa ring dating mamamahayag.

Hinirang naman na bakanteng puwesto na Assistant General Manager sa National Housing Authority (NHA) si Alvin Feliciano.

Ilan pa sa mga bagong nabigyan ng posisyon sa gobyerno ay sina:

Karlo Fermin Adriano - Assistant Secretary, Department of Finance
Alberto Francisco Pascual - Acting President and Chief Executive Officer and Member of Board of Directors, Philippine Guarantee Corporation
Gilbert Cacatian - Director IV, Department of Labor and Employment
George Almaden - Director IV, Office for Transportation Security, Department of Transportation
Karen Kreez Tangco-Pascasio - Director IV, Governance Commission for Government-owned-or-controlled Corporations; and
Vanessa Grace Samson - Head Executive Assistant, Presidential Legislative Liaison Office.
